图书介绍
微型计算机原理与接口技术 第4版pdf电子书版本下载
- 杨立,邓振杰,荆淑霞等编著 著
- 出版社: 北京:中国铁道出版社
- ISBN:7113214193
- 出版时间:2016
- 标注页数:332页
- 文件大小:157MB
- 文件页数:346页
- 主题词:微型计算机-理论-高等学校-教材;微型计算机-接口技术-高等学校-教材
PDF下载
下载说明
微型计算机原理与接口技术 第4版PDF格式电子书版下载
下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如 B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!
(文件页数 要大于 标注页数,上中下等多册电子书除外)
注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具
图书目录
第1章 微型计算机基础知识 1
1.1 微型计算机概述 1
1.1.1 微处理器的产生和发展 1
1.1.2 微型计算机分类 3
1.1.3 微型计算机特点 4
1.1.4 微型计算机性能指标 5
1.2 微型计算机硬件结构及其功能 5
1.2.1 微型计算机硬件基本结构 6
1.2.2 微型计算机各模块基本功能 6
1.3 微型计算机系统 9
1.3.1 微型计算机系统组成 9
1.3.2 微型计算机常用软件 10
1.3.3 软硬件之间的关系 11
1.4 计算机中的数制及其转换 12
1.4.1 数制的基本概念 12
1.4.2 数制之间的转换 13
1.5 计算机中机器数的表示 15
1.5.1 机器数表示方法 15
1.5.2 带符号数的原码、反码、补码表示 15
1.5.3 定点数和浮点数的表示 17
1.5.4 数据溢出及其判断 18
1.6 计算机中常用编码 18
1.6.1 美国信息交换标准代码 18
1.6.2 二-十进制编码——BCD码 20
本章小结 21
思考与练习题 21
第2章 典型微处理器 23
2.1 微处理器性能简介 23
2.1.1 处理器主要性能指标 23
2.1.2 微处理器基本功能 24
2.2 Intel 8086微处理器内外部结构 24
2.2.1 8086微处理器内部结构 24
2.2.2 8086微处理器寄存器结构 27
2.2.3 8086微处理器外部特性 30
2.3 存储器和I/O组织 32
2.3.1 存储器组织 32
2.3.2 I/O端口组织 36
2.4 8086微处理器总线周期和工作方式 37
2.4.1 8284A时钟信号发生器 37
2.4.2 8086总线周期 38
2.4.3 8086微处理器最小/最大工作方式 39
2.5 8086微处理器操作时序 41
2.5.1 系统复位和启动操作 42
2.5.2 总线操作 42
2.5.3 暂停操作 43
2.5.4 中断响应总线周期操作 43
2.5.5 总线保持请求/保持响应操作 44
2.6 32位微处理器简介 45
2.6.1 80386微处理器 45
2.6.2 80486微处理器 46
2.6.3 Pentium系列微处理器 48
2.6.4 Pentium微处理器采用的新技术 52
本章小结 53
思考与练习题 54
第3章 寻址方式与指令系统 56
3.1 指令格式及寻址 56
3.1.1 指令系统与指令格式 56
3.1.2 寻址的概念及操作数类别 57
3.2 8086寻址方式及其应用 57
3.2.1 与操作数有关的寻址方式 58
3.2.2 与I/O端口地址有关的寻址方式 60
3.3 8086指令系统及其应用 61
3.3.1 数据传送类指令 61
3.3.2 算术运算类指令 64
3.3.3 逻辑运算与移位类指令 67
3.3.4 串操作类指令 70
3.3.5 控制转移类指令 72
3.3.6 处理器控制类指令 75
3.3.7 中断调用指令 76
3.4 DOS和BIOS中断调用 77
3.4.1 DOS功能调用 77
3.4.2 BIOS中断调用 78
3.5 Pentium微处理器新增寻址方式和指令 79
3.5.1 Pentium微处理器的内部寄存器 79
3.5.2 Pentium微处理器的新增寻址方式 80
3.5.3 Pentium系列微处理器专用指令 81
3.5.4 Pentium系列微处理器控制指令 81
本章小结 82
思考与练习题 82
第4章 汇编语言及程序设计 85
4.1 汇编语言简述 85
4.1.1 汇编语言及语句格式 85
4.1.2 汇编语言标识符、表达式和运算符 86
4.1.3 汇编语言源程序结构 89
4.2 汇编语言常用伪指令 90
4.2.1 数据定义伪指令 91
4.2.2 符号定义伪指令 92
4.2.3 段定义伪指令 93
4.2.4 过程定义伪指令 94
4.2.5 结构定义伪指令 95
4.2.6 模块定义与连接伪指令 96
4.2.7 程序计数器$和ORG伪指令 97
4.3 汇编语言程序上机过程 97
4.3.1 汇编语言的工作环境 97
4.3.2 汇编语言上机操作步骤 98
4.4 汇编语言程序设计 99
4.4.1 程序设计基本步骤及程序结构 99
4.4.2 顺序结构程序设计 100
4.4.3 分支结构程序设计 101
4.4.4 循环结构程序设计 104
4.4.5 子程序设计 107
4.4.6 DOS调用程序设计 109
4.5 高级汇编技术 111
4.5.1 宏指令与宏汇编 111
4.5.2 重复汇编 113
4.5.3 条件汇编 115
本章小结 117
思考与练习题 118
第5章 总线技术 120
5.1 概述 120
5.1.1 总线的概念 120
5.1.2 总线的结构 121
5.1.3 总线的分类 122
5.1.4 总线性能及总线标准 123
5.1.5 总线传输和控制 124
5.2 系统总线 125
5.2.1 概述 125
5.2.2 ISA总线 125
5.3 局部总线 130
5.3.1 PCI总线 131
5.3.2 AGP总线 133
5.4 外围设备总线 134
5.4.1 USB通用串行总线 134
5.4.2 IEEE 1394总线 137
5.5 I2C总线 139
5.5.1 I2C总线简介 139
5.5.2 I2C总线特性 140
5.5.3 I2C总线工作原理 140
本章小结 141
思考与练习题 142
第6章 存储器系统 144
6.1 存储器概述 144
6.1.1 存储器分类 144
6.1.2 存储器常用性能指标 145
6.1.3 存储系统层次结构 146
6.2 半导体存储器 147
6.2.1 概述 147
6.2.2 随机存储器(RAM) 149
6.2.3 只读存储器(ROM) 153
6.3 存储器扩展与寻址 156
6.3.1 位扩展 157
6.3.2 字扩展 157
6.3.3 字位扩展 157
6.3.4 存储器的寻址 158
6.4 存储器与CPU的连接 159
6.4.1 连接时注意问题 159
6.4.2 典型微处理器与存储器的连接 160
6.5 辅助存储器 161
6.5.1 硬盘存储器 161
6.5.2 光盘存储器 166
6.6 新型存储器技术 169
6.6.1 多体交叉存储器 169
6.6.2 高速缓冲存储器(Cache) 170
6.6.3 虚拟存储器 172
6.6.4 闪速存储器 177
本章小结 180
思考与练习题 181
第7章 输入/输出接口技术 183
7.1 概述 183
7.1.1 输入/输出接口电路要解决的问题 183
7.1.2 输入/输出接口的结构与功能 184
7.1.3 I/O端口的编址方式 186
7.2 输入/输出数据传送方式 187
7.2.1 无条件传送方式 187
7.2.2 查询传送方式 188
7.2.3 中断传送方式 191
7.2.4 DMA传送方式 192
7.2.5 通道方式 195
本章小结 196
思考与练习题 197
第8章 可编程DMA控制器8237A 198
8.1 概述 198
8.1.1 8237A主要功能 198
8.1.2 8237A工作状态 199
8.2 8237A内部结构及引脚 199
8.2.1 8237A内部结构 199
8.2.2 8237A引脚及功能 200
8.3 8237A工作方式 202
8.3.1 单字节传送方式 202
8.3.2 数据块传送方式 203
8.3.3 请求传送方式 203
8.3.4 级连传送方式 203
8.4 8237A内部寄存器功能及格式 204
8.4.1 当前地址寄存器 204
8.4.2 当前字节数寄存器 205
8.4.3 基地址寄存器 205
8.4.4 基字节寄存器 205
8.4.5 命令寄存器 205
8.4.6 工作方式寄存器 206
8.4.7 请求寄存器 207
8.4.8 屏蔽寄存器 208
8.4.9 状态寄存器 208
8.4.10 暂存寄存器 209
8.4.11 软件命令 209
8.5 8237A编程及应用 209
8.5.1 8237A主要寄存器端口地址分配 209
8.5.2 8237A编程一般步骤 210
8.5.3 8237A应用举例 212
本章小结 215
思考与练习题 216
第9章 中断技术 217
9.1 概述 217
9.1.1 中断的概念 217
9.1.2 中断源 219
9.1.3 中断处理过程 219
9.1.4 中断优先级管理 221
9.1.5 单级中断与多级中断 224
9.2 8086中断系统 224
9.2.1 中断类型 225
9.2.2 中断向量表 227
9.2.3 8086中断处理过程 228
9.3 可编程中断控制器8259A及其应用 231
9.3.1 8259A内部结构及引脚 231
9.3.2 8259A中断管理方式 233
9.3.3 8259A中断响应过程 236
9.3.4 8259A编程及应用 237
本章小结 244
思考与练习题 245
第10章 可编程并行接口芯片8255A 246
10.1 并行接口概述 246
10.1.1 并行接口的分类 246
10.1.2 并行接口的特点 247
10.1.3 并行接口的功能 247
10.2 并行接口芯片8255A 247
10.2.1 8255A内部结构及引脚 248
10.2.2 8255A工作方式 250
10.2.3 8255A编程及应用 256
本章小结 260
思考与练习题 260
第11章 可编程串行接口芯片8251A 262
11.1 串行传输的基本概念 262
11.1.1 串行通信概述 262
11.1.2 信号的调制与解调 264
11.2 串行接口芯片8251A 264
11.2.1 8251A基本性能 264
11.2.2 8251A内部结构与引脚 265
11.2.3 8251A编程控制 268
11.2.4 8251A初始化和编程应用 269
11.3 PC串行异步通信接口 273
11.3.1 RS-232串行通信接口 273
11.3.2 BIOS串行异步通信接口的功能调用 274
本章小结 277
思考与练习题 278
第12章 可编程定时器/计数器接口芯片8253 279
12.1 概述 279
12.1.1 定时器/计数器基本原理 279
12.1.2 8253的特点 279
12.2 8253内部结构和引脚功能 280
12.2.1 8253内部结构 280
12.2.2 8253引脚功能 280
12.3 8253初始化及工作方式 281
12.3.1 8253初始化 281
12.3.2 8253工作方式 283
12.4 8253的应用 288
12.4.1 8253初始化编程 288
12.4.2 8253应用实例 289
本章小结 290
思考与练习题 290
第13章 人机交互设备及接口 292
13.1 概述 292
13.2 键盘与鼠标 292
13.2.1 键盘及接口电路 292
13.2.2 PC键盘接口及其应用 295
13.2.3 鼠标及接口电路 298
13.3 显示器及其接口 300
13.3.1 CRT显示器 300
13.3.2 LED与LCD显示 304
13.4 打印机及其接口 308
13.4.1 常用打印机及工作原理 308
13.4.2 打印机中断调用 309
13.5 其他外设简介 309
13.5.1 扫描仪原理及其应用 309
13.5.2 数码照相机原理及其应用 310
13.5.3 触摸屏原理及其应用 311
本章小结 312
思考与练习题 312
第14章 D/A及A/D转换器 314
14.1 概述 314
14.2 典型D/A转换器及其应用 314
14.2.1 D/A转换器工作原理 314
14.2.2 D/A转换器主要性能指标 316
14.2.3 DAC0832及其应用 316
14.3 典型A/D转换器及其应用 322
14.3.1 A/D转换器工作原理 322
14.3.2 A/D转换器主要性能指标 323
14.3.3 ADC0809及其应用 323
14.3.4 A/D转换器选择原则 329
14.4 A/D和D/A转换应用实例 330
本章小结 331
思考与练习题 331
参考文献 332